    Who We Are

    Our Mission

    Palomino Hope is committed to enriching the lives of children and veterans through transformative equine-assisted experiences. By cultivating meaningful connections with horses and fostering supportive peer relationships, we strive to inspire healing, personal development, and a strong sense of community. Our innovative youth-mentor system lies at the heart of our approach, empowering participants to grow and thrive together.
